Red Sox Dominate Nationals with Explosive Fifth Inning at Nationals Park
The Boston Red Sox improved their season record to 44-45 after a commanding 11-2 victory over the Washington Nationals, who now stand at 37-51. The game, held at Nationals Park, saw an attendance of 37,355 fans witnessing the Red Sox's offensive prowess.
First Inning
The game began with both teams unable to score in the first inning. The Red Sox managed two hits but couldn't capitalize on them. Meanwhile, the Nationals were kept hitless by Lucas Giolito's effective pitching for Boston.
Second Inning
Boston took an early lead in the second inning with two runs scored off three hits. Abraham Toro contributed significantly with a key RBI single that set the tone for his team's aggressive approach throughout the game.
Fifth Inning
The fifth inning was pivotal as it marked a turning point in favor of Boston. The Red Sox exploded offensively, scoring seven runs on six hits. This barrage included contributions from multiple players and showcased their depth and ability to string together productive at-bats against Washington's pitching staff.
Sixth through Eighth Innings
While both teams remained scoreless in innings six and seven, Boston added two more runs in the eighth inning to extend their lead further. Jarren Duran was instrumental during this period with his consistent hitting performance that bolstered his team's advantage.
Ninth Inning
In a final attempt to rally back into contention during their last chance at bat, Washington managed one run but fell short against Boston’s solid defensive play led by Trevor Story’s impeccable fielding skills throughout all nine innings.
